River Life
by
Pafu
River of rivers, courses of waters
Here at the shore where they end
Thru all dislevels, ever it races
Flood that delivers life to all takers.
Wrinkled our faces, with scars in places
We're named after captains that came
Long before we spoke they murmured
Hymns with refrains of praise.
Rivers of life, caressing the earth
Ample and wide, rough coursing first
We have survived, and now no tide
Or wave can the horizon hide.
